Best Places for Avid Bird Watchers

Uttarakhand 10 Best Places for Avid Bird Watchers

Uttarakhand 10 Best Places for Avid Bird Watchers

Saptahik Patrika

Uttarakhand, nestled in the lap of the Himalayas, is a haven for nature enthusiasts and bird watchers. This northern Indian ...

Mr. Kumar

Typically replies within a hours

error: Content is protected !!